History and Significance of COEX

Origins and Development

COEX was established in 1979 as part of the Korea International Trade Association (KITA) initiative to create a comprehensive trade and exhibition hub. The center was designed to bolster South Korea’s burgeoning economy by providing a state-of-the-art venue for international trade shows, conventions, and exhibitions.

Architectural Evolution

The COEX complex has undergone several expansions and renovations to maintain its status as a premier venue. The most significant expansion occurred in 2000, coinciding with the opening of the COEX Mall, one of the largest underground shopping malls in Asia. The architectural design of COEX blends modernity with functionality, featuring sleek glass facades and expansive interiors designed to accommodate large-scale events.

Travel Tips

COEX is easily accessible via public transportation. The nearest subway station is Samseong Station (Line 2), which directly connects to the COEX complex. Visitors are advised to check the official COEX website for the latest travel advisories and updates.

Special Events

COEX hosts numerous international events, including trade shows, conventions, and cultural exhibitions. Highlights include the G20 Seoul Summit in 2010 and the Nuclear Security Summit in 2012. The annual Seoul International Book Fair is another major event that attracts literary enthusiasts from around the world.

Technological Advancements and Environmental Initiatives

Technological Advancements

COEX is renowned for its integration of cutting-edge technology to enhance the visitor experience. The center is equipped with advanced audiovisual systems, high-speed internet connectivity, and state-of-the-art facilities to support large-scale events. In 2017, COEX introduced the “Smart MICE” platform, a digital solution designed to streamline event planning and management.

Environmental Initiatives

COEX has implemented various green initiatives, including energy-efficient lighting, waste reduction programs, and eco-friendly building materials. In 2019, COEX received the ISO 20121 certification for sustainable event management.
